驱动之家 昨天
极致硬核!爆肝6个月手搓Intel 486主板:Linux、Windows全跑通
index_new5.html
../../../zaker_core/zaker_tpl_static/wap/tpl_keji1.html

 

快科技 1 月 27 日消息,程序员兼电子爱好者 Maniek86 历时近 6 个月,从底层原理图画起,独立设计 PCB 并实现芯片组逻辑,亲手打造出一块功能完整的 Intel 486 架构主板 M8SBC-486。

这块主板不仅能稳定运行 Linux、MS-DOS、FreeDOS 等操作系统,还能流畅运行《毁灭战士》《德军总部 3D》等经典游戏,甚至在特定环境下成功启动 Windows 3.1。

Maniek86 强调,这块主板并非基于旧设计改良,而是完全从零开始设计,包括芯片逻辑、引脚时序和 BIOS 代码。

这意味着他需要深入理解 486 CPU 的总线协议、时钟逻辑、中断控制和存储读写时序等底层细节。

在个人博客中,他详细记录了从焊接电阻、电容等小型元件,到攻克 144 引脚 FPGA 芯片和 ATMega128 微控制器等核心部件的焊接过程,甚至为 PGA 插槽设计了切割拼接的 DIP 插座。

测试阶段自然也充满了挑战,Maniek86 遇到了 SRAM 元件贴标倒置导致的短路、芯片封装混淆、中断控制器缺失等问题,但他通过临时添加下拉电阻、自制适配器等方法逐一解决了这些难题。

最终,在示波器的辅助下,他成功让 486 CPU 在自制主板上运行起无限循环程序,并逐步实现了 ISA 总线功能,完成了从硬件焊接到基础功能验证的全流程突破。

目前,Maniek86 已将该项目的原理图、PCB 设计文件及 BIOS 源代码全部在 GitHub 开源,他坦言这块板子仍有提升空间,未来计划进一步完善 ISA 扩展和 PC 兼容性。

宙世代

宙世代

ZAKER旗下Web3.0元宇宙平台

一起剪

一起剪

ZAKER旗下免费视频剪辑工具

相关标签

linux 芯片 windows intel
相关文章
评论
没有更多评论了
取消

登录后才可以发布评论哦

打开小程序可以发布评论哦

12 我来说两句…
打开 ZAKER 参与讨论